Kate Thorpe is an experienced Delivery Lead and Director with a background in managing large-scale digital transformation projects and cross-functional teams across various sectors. Currently serving as a Delivery Lead at Edit, Kate has held significant roles at KARMA PROJECTS LTD, Dyson, and multiple other organizations, where responsibilities ranged from overseeing CRM enhancements to leading data-driven marketing strategies. With expertise in Agile methodologies and stakeholder management, Kate has successfully delivered multimillion-pound projects and coached teams in best practices. Educational credentials include a BSc in Media Lab Arts from the University of Plymouth.

Edit

Edit deliver data solutions, customer acquisition and retention campaigns for some of the world’s most recognised brands, including Jaguar Land Rover, Tesco Bank, and The British Heart Foundation. Based out of London and Bath, Edit’s team consists of data scientists, engineers, technology strategists, and planners who are focused on delivering attributable growth for businesses across any sector. With bespoke planning, campaign delivery, data strategy, and our technology expertise, our teams navigate your needs to find the right solutions for your business. We deliver projects via our proprietary delivery framework, Orbit. This agile, sprint-based engagement model comprises distinct, iterative time-boxed phases to ensure solutions are delivered to agreed specifications, on budget and on time. In February 2022 Edit achieved B Corp, certifying that we meet the highest standards of social and environmental performance, accountability, and transparency. We continue to commit to a triple bottom approach which focuses on three P’s: people, profit, and planet. Edit is wholly owned by The Salocin Group. The Salocin Group’s mission is to make a measurable difference for clients, colleagues, and community, through the ethical application of data and technology in marketing.
